Advice for procrastinators in the face of a hard fork

Hey everyone, be sure your bitcoin is in a wallet where YOU control the private keys! A fork of bitcoin is highly likely on Tuesday August 1st. If you have the 12-word backup, that means you have the keys. That means you’ll have the same amount of “Bitcoin Cash” (BCC) as you do original BItcoin after the fork. A few wallets like Jaxx and Coinomi have announced direct support for Bitcoin Cash is coming, with others you may have to jump a few hoops if you want your BCC sooner rather than later.

Alternately, if you want to trust your coin to an exchange, Kraken and Bitfinex have pledged to split off your new BCC automatically. As long as they don’t get hacked in the time your coins are there, you should be okay doing it that way.
